Ques:- A clerk multiplied a number by ten when it should have been divided by ten.The ans he got was 100.what should the ans have been?
Recent Answer :
: Let the number be X,
Instead of dividing the number by 10, i.e.,X*10.
he got the result as 100,
so, (X*10)=100
X=100/10
X=10.
BUt he has to divide X by 10,
so, X/10=10/10=1.
obviously the answer is 1.

Ques:- Perimeter of the back wheel = 9 feet, front wheel = 7 feet on a certain distance, the front wheel gets 10 revolutions more than the back wheel .What is the distance?
Recent Answer :
: Let the revolutins made by bigger wheel is: x
then revolution by smaller wheel will be: x+10
Now, the distance covered by both wheels will be same.
So,
7(x+10)=9x
7x+70=9x
70=2x
35=x
so distance travelled=9*35=315
or 7*45=315
